Recent Price Movement and Market Context

Kajaria Ceramics closed at ₹950.00 on 25 Feb 2026, down 4.53% from the previous close of ₹995.05. The intraday range saw a high of ₹992.15 and a low of ₹945.30, reflecting heightened volatility. The stock remains well below its 52-week high of ₹1,322.00 but comfortably above its 52-week low of ₹745.00. This price contraction contrasts with the broader market, where the Sensex has shown mixed returns over various periods.

Year-to-date, Kajaria Ceramics has declined by 1.90%, while the Sensex has fallen 3.51%, indicating a relatively better performance in the current calendar year. Over the last year, the stock has delivered a 10.02% return, closely tracking the Sensex’s 10.44% gain. However, longer-term returns reveal underperformance, with a three-year loss of 10.33% against the Sensex’s 38.28% rise and a five-year flat return of 0.24% versus Sensex’s 61.92% growth.

Technical Trend Analysis: From Mildly Bearish to Bearish

The technical trend for Kajaria Ceramics has shifted from mildly bearish to outright bearish, signalling a deterioration in momentum. The daily moving averages have turned bearish, with the stock price trading below key averages, indicating sustained selling pressure. This is corroborated by the weekly and monthly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) indicators, both firmly bearish, suggesting that momentum is weakening across multiple timeframes.

The Relative Strength Index (RSI) on weekly and monthly charts currently shows no clear signal, hovering in neutral territory. This lack of momentum confirmation from RSI implies that the stock is neither oversold nor overbought, but the absence of bullish RSI divergence adds to the cautious technical outlook.

Bollinger Bands and KST Indicator Insights

Bollinger Bands on the weekly chart have turned bearish, with the price moving towards the lower band, indicating increased volatility and downward pressure. The monthly Bollinger Bands are mildly bearish, suggesting that while the longer-term trend is weakening, it is not yet decisively negative.

The Know Sure Thing (KST) indicator presents a mixed picture: weekly KST is bearish, reinforcing short-term negative momentum, whereas the monthly KST is mildly bullish, hinting at some underlying longer-term strength. This divergence between weekly and monthly KST readings suggests that while short-term traders may face headwinds, longer-term investors might find some support in the stock’s technical structure.

Volume and Trend Confirmation Indicators

On-Balance Volume (OBV) analysis shows no clear trend on the weekly chart but a mildly bullish signal on the monthly timeframe. This suggests that while recent trading volumes have not decisively supported the price decline, there is some accumulation over the longer term. However, the Dow Theory readings are less encouraging, with no clear trend on the weekly chart and a mildly bearish stance on the monthly chart, reinforcing the overall cautious technical environment.

The combination of bearish MACD, moving averages, and Bollinger Bands, alongside neutral RSI and mixed KST and OBV signals, paints a complex picture. The dominant theme remains bearish in the short term, with some potential for stabilisation or recovery in the medium to long term.
